Senior Highways Engineer
 
Our client is looking for a Senior Highways Engineer to join their team in East Grinstead.
 
The successful candidate will contribute to the development and implementation of projects and programmes of work whilst undertaking a range of technical aspects required for project delivery.
 
Requirements of the role:
·Arranging the procurement of highway improvement works through competitive tendering.
·Undertaking feasibility studies including preparing reports, cost estimates, investigating problems, and identifying of options.
·Supervising and monitoring works on site, making valuations for payment assessments, chairing and managing progress meetings.
 
Requirements of the role:
 
·A Bachelors or master's degree in Civil Engineering or a related subject accredited by the Engineering Council OR you will already be or fast approaching Chartered Member status of the Institution of Civil Engineers (CEng MICE).
·Experience in the design, implementation, and supervision of all aspects of highways and civil engineering design and construction.
·Design experience and Civils' 3D capability
·An extensive knowledge and understanding of the relevant legislation, standards, and procedures.
